GPA signs 350,000 naming rights deal with phone company

THE Gaelic Players' Association yesterday announced a five-year 350,000 naming rights deal with mobile phone company The Carphone Warehouse.

The players’ body will now be known as ‘The Carphone Warehouse sponsored GPA’ and the deal is an extension of an existing three-year contract between the two organisations.

The agreement is chief executive Dessie Farrell’s first major commercial result for the GPA. The package is structured to provide performance related bonuses for the GPA, recognising the association’s growing prominence in Gaelic games.
